According to initial reports, the incident began inside a popular Hvar nightclub. Details are still emerging, but eyewitnesses describe a rapidly escalating situation involving Jon Vlogs and his entourage. What exactly triggered the disturbance remains unclear, with some speculating about a misunderstanding, while others hint at a more deliberate provocation. Regardless of the cause, the situation quickly spiraled out of control, drawing the attention of local authorities.
The arrival of the police reportedly intensified the chaos. Accounts suggest a heated confrontation between Jon Vlogs and law enforcement officers, culminating in his detention. This police clash YouTuber incident is particularly alarming, as it moves beyond mere public disturbance to a direct confrontation with the authorities of a foreign nation. "It was a scene straight out of a movie," an alleged club-goer recounted, "Lots of shouting, flashing lights, and then they just took him away."
